Add to basketCondition: Near Fine. Jacket Condition: Very Good +. 1st Edition. Blue boards with gilt stamped titles to the spine, 255(1)pp with original unclipped dust jacket priced at 18s net. A near fine copy with clean boards, bright titles and firm sharp corners. Internally there is no name inscription or bookplate and the book appears unread noting a faint strip of toning/acid migration to the free endpapers where the dust jacket does not reach and a hint of spotting to the edges of the text block. The dust jacket, which is now protected in a removable, clear cover (not shown), has some toning to the spine and edges and a little dust staining and toning to the rear panel. Published in the US under the title Sweeny's Island, this is a very hard to find Christopher work.
